- [ ] **Step 7: Breaker override escrow.** After sealing the signing keys for the Tallgrove upstream API circuit breaker, confirm the support team can force the breaker open during a full outage. The override bundle lives in the sealed escrow drawer and is useless without its unlock phrase. Two ceremony witnesses must initial this step before proceeding. The escrow bundle is decrypted with the recovery passphrase that follows.

vault phrase of kahip-kahop = holath-quenmir

Leadership Review Briefing — Loyalty Programme Overhaul. The Brightmark Rewards scheme has underperformed since the tier restructure: redemption rates fell 14% and enrolment stalled across the Velden region. The proposed overhaul replaces points with spend-based credits, consolidates three partner tiers into one, and sunsets the legacy card by Q3. Costs are within the approved envelope, though migration of dormant accounts carries some churn risk. The strategic rationale is set out below.

board note of baguf-fafog: Kasixox Foods plans to lower the Drueth list price by 48 percent in March.

Key ceremony checklist, item 7 (Norwhistle release manager): confirm the Lanternjack scheduler for nightly data backfills is paused before key rotation begins. Backfill jobs hold stale credentials in memory and will fail loudly mid-ceremony otherwise. After rotation, resume the scheduler and verify the 02:00 Greymoor backfill completes. Resuming requires vault access, which during the ceremony window is gated by the recovery passphrase noted directly below.

unlock words, yawig-kagef: gordor-holvan-ulaael-pramir-ulaiel-tamdor